Movie posters

The official poster for Indiana Jones and the Kingdom of the Crystal Skull has just been released, so have a look at this great piece of artwork by Drew Struzan—who also made the Star Wars posters, but also those for Harry Potter and the Back to the Future trilogy, among others.
